Memorable canon moments, bizarre omakes, tantalizing magazine spreads—this is the round to explore them all. Bring out your screencaps, promotional art, and manga pages, and let's talk about what really happened.
Please read the rules carefully before posting!


RULES
  • Submit prompts in the form of a canon screencap from one of our nominated fandoms along with a ship. Screencaps can be from an anime or manga, as well as any other kind of offshoot media, e.g. official art, drama CD covers, light novel illustrations, magazine covers, and/or caps from games. Doujinshi, fan-made games or any other fan-created work should not be prompted, even if you receive permission. Only prompt screencaps that are taken from a piece of canon media.
  • Keep your prompt concise. Don't prompt a whole manga chapter, for example.
  • Upload the cap somewhere (imgur works well) and post here with the images themselves or a link to them.
  • Your prompt MUST include some kind of relationship. Platonic relationships are indicated by an "&" between the names (e.g., Riko & Momoi). Non-platonic relationships use "/" (e.g., Riko/Momoi). Please don't say "Any pairing," either!
  • Fill prompts by leaving a responding comment to the prompt with your newly-created work inspired by the cap.
  • Fills can be directly connected to the cap, e.g. panel redraws or writing fic that fleshes out the moment that was capped or that fleshes out what happened directly before/after, but fills can also be more indirectly linked. As long as the work is somehow inspired by the cap, it counts.

The spring air was cool on Ikejiri Hayato’s skin after volleyball practice that particular night. His feet were grazing the sand underneath the swingset his sat in, tears forming at the corners of his eyes from the realization that soon would be his last game of his junior high volleyball career and his final game with him.

Sawamura Daichi.

The boy that swung on the swingset next to him.

Ikejiri’s eyes couldn’t pull away from Daichi if he tried. Out of anyone Ikejiri had ever met, he’s never known someone with the resolve in Daichi’s voice, his stance on the court, his everything. Daichi was a foundation on which Ikejiri could build so many dreams.

But dreams can crumble when that foundation is close to drifting away.

“Daichi,” Ikejiri mumbled, watching the boy dig his heels into the sand under the swings to slow his swing to a stop, “Did you really mean that the other day?”

“Huh? Mean what?” Daichi tilted his head slightly in confusion.

“When you said ‘We'll never win if we don't believe we can?’ Even though we lost,” Ikejiri’s eyesight was muddying and not cool Hayato, now’s not the time to cry.

Daichi’s blank stare warmed into a smile as he reached his hand from the chain of the swing to Ikejiri’s shoulder. Ikejiri shuttered at the touch. In the lighting of the streetlamp over the park, Daichi’s features were accentuated and in, in that moment, Ikejiri felt as though his heart was going to burst out of his chest.

How can anyone be this gorgeous, Ikejiri gulped the thought down and hid in as far from his tongue as possible.

“Hayato, it’s simple; because I believe in us,” Daichi said, nodding once.

Ikejiri could have fallen over from cardiac arrest. The way Daichi worded that could have been interpreted as “us” being the team, and deep down, Ikejiri knew that.

But Ikejiri realized, then, that he wished more than anything, that “us” meant the two of them, together.

But he knew better.

“But we won’t be a team anymore soon,” Ikejiri felt his breath hitch, the tears in his eyes falling.

“Mm, that’s true,” Daichi looked up into the night sky and kicked his feet under the swing, “But just because we won’t be on the same team, doesn’t mean we can’t play together again.”

Ikejiri’s tears continued to flow, the pain in his heart still deep but the promise of playing together again.

We’ll definitely play again, Sawamura Daichi….


“...Ikejiri?” Daichi tilted his head, standing across from Ikejiri after Karasuno defeated Tokonami in the Inter High preliminaries.

“Nothing,” Ikejiri averted his gaze down from Daichi, a blush crossing his face, “I was just… thinking of when we were in Junior High….”
